Subject: RemindrJob cutover — Friday

Team,

The Bluefinch Clinic appointment reminder job moves to the Parkvale partner endpoint Friday 06:00. Payload schema unchanged; retries drop from 5 to 3. Release manager signs off once your staging run confirms delivery receipts. Do not enable SMS fallback until Meadowlark ops confirms quota. Rollback plan: re-point to legacy queue, no data migration needed. Staging auth rotates tonight. Use the token below for all staging calls until cutover completes.

session JWT of yawep-yawep = eyJhbGciOiJIUzI1NiIsInR5cCI6IkpXVCJ9.eyJzdWIiOiI3pWF3_In0.aXYsHiog

## TICKET-4471: Config drift in Fernpath offline mode

The Fernpath field-survey app's offline mode behaves differently across the three regional deployments. Surveyors in the Kestrel region report a 48-hour offline window, while others get 24 hours — the sync-retention setting was hand-edited on one cluster and never backported. Please review the attached diff and confirm which value should be canonical before we re-provision. For reference, the intended baseline configuration, as committed to the templates repo, is as follows:

deployment values, kajep-kageg:
[praix]
host = praix.paliqcorp.corp
user = praix_svc
database = praix_prod

Action item from the Glimmerfall v3.2 postmortem: uncompressed telemetry payloads from plugins overwhelmed the ingest tier during peak load. Starting with SDK 4.0, all plugin telemetry must be gzip-compressed client-side before submission; uncompressed payloads over 64 KB will be rejected. Plugin authors should migrate by the next release window. Sample code, the compression spec, and the rejection error codes are published on the page below.

dashboard of tagag-kadug = https://confluence.zemvarsys.internal/projects/projects/display/pages

## Who to ping about GiftNote

Welcome aboard! GiftNote is our donation-receipt mailer for the Larchfield Fund. Template tweaks go to the comms folks; delivery failures and bounce weirdness go to the platform crew. Don't push template changes on Fridays — receipts batch over the weekend. For anything GiftNote-related, start with the address below.

billing contact of kaweg-tajeg = drudor.lamion.oliath@torvalabs.test